Output 2eee2099f33e69d7052308fae5918b8245ee952e92090d5abdba5d7ed0654be5:2

value
75356889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dfd108894443c5cd60413e37464ed2705333ff4 OP_EQUAL
address
MRDj6vQpagJPYhadCbU1cC9wuHXX5QRzL1
transaction
2eee2099f33e69d7052308fae5918b8245ee952e92090d5abdba5d7ed0654be5
spent
true